Understanding ADHD: Exploring Free Online Tests

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that impacts countless children and often continues into their adult years. Defined by symptoms such as neg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ity, ADHD can significantly impact daily performance, scholastic performance, and social relationships. As awareness of ADHD continues to grow, many people seek options to comprehend this condition much better. One popular technique is taking online tests, which can offer preliminary insights into prospective ADHD symptoms.

The Importance of Early Detection

Early detection of ADHD is essential as it enables people to get timely intervention and assistance. Acknowledging symptoms early can cause better scholastic and social results for kids, while adults may benefit from comprehending their obstacles and exploring coping techniques. Online tests can function as an accessible primary step for those who suspect they or their child may have ADHD.

How Do ADHD Online Tests Work?

ADHD online tests normally consist of a series of questions or statements connected to behaviors and experiences commonly related to ADHD. Participants respond to these queries based upon their experiences over a specific timeframe (usually the previous 6 months). The tests are often designed to identify patterns of habits characteristic of ADHD.

Here's a streamlined introduction of how these tests normally operate:

  1. Questionnaire Format: The test makes up multiple-choice concerns or Likert-scale statements where respondents indicate how often they experience particular behaviors.

  2. Scoring System: Each response is appointed a point worth. After finishing the test, the total score is computed based on agreed-upon criteria correlating with ADHD symptoms.

  3. Interpretation: Depending on ball game, people might receive feedback classifying their results into various varieties (e.g., low-risk, moderate-risk, high-risk).

While these tests are informative, it's vital to highlight that they do not change professional diagnosis. Instead, they function as a helpful tool for seeking further examination.

Factors to consider Before Taking an Online Test

While the benefits of online tests are numerous, possible users should consider a couple of cautions:

  1. Limitations of Self-reporting: Responses depend upon individual awareness and interpretation of their habits, which can be subjective.

  2. Accuracy and Reliance: Many online tests lack empirical support and needs to not be trusted for diagnosis. They are simply screening tools.

  3. Follow-up Consultation: High-risk outcomes ought to trigger an assessment with qualified healthcare professionals for a thorough examination.

Q1: Are online ADHD tests accurate?

A1: Online ADHD tests provide a general indication of whether someone might show symptoms of ADHD, but they are not diagnostic tools. Their precision can differ based on the test's style and the participant's sincerity.

Q2: What should I do if I score high on an online test?

A2: If you score in the high-risk variety, consider setting up a visit with a psychological health professional for an official assessment.

Q3: Can these tests be taken numerous times?

A3: Yes, people can take these tests multiple times to track changes in symptoms. However, it is recommended to analyze the results very carefully.

Q4: What age group can benefit from online ADHD tests?

A4: Online tests can benefit both children and adults, but tests designed for kids typically need input from parents or guardians for precision.
